Honeymoon Itinerary in Singapore

Wednesday, February 7: Exploring Gardens by the Bay

Start your honeymoon in Singapore by visiting the iconic Gardens by the Bay. In the morning, take a romantic stroll through the beautiful Flower Dome and Cloud Forest, two of the largest glass greenhouses in the world. Enjoy the vibrant displays of flowers and admire the stunning indoor waterfall. In the afternoon, head to the Supertree Grove and be amazed by the futuristic tree-like structures. Catch the daily light and sound show, "Garden Rhapsody," in the evening for a magical experience.

  • Gardens by the Bay: Estimated cost - Free entry, additional fees for Flower Dome and Cloud Forest. Estimated time spent - 4 hours
  • Supertree Grove: Estimated cost - Free, additional fees for OCBC Skyway. Estimated time spent - 1 hour
  • "Garden Rhapsody" Light and Sound Show: Estimated cost - Free. Estimated time spent - 20 minutes
Thursday, February 8: Exploring Sentosa Island

Spend a day on Sentosa Island, a resort island filled with attractions and beautiful beaches. In the morning, visit Universal Studios Singapore for thrilling rides and live entertainment. In the afternoon, relax on the sandy beaches of Palawan or Siloso Beach. Take a romantic stroll along the Southernmost Point of Continental Asia and enjoy panoramic views. In the evening, catch the Wings of Time show, a mesmerizing multimedia spectacle featuring water, laser, and fire effects.

  • Universal Studios Singapore: Estimated cost - Check prices here. Estimated time spent - 6 hours
  • Sentosa Beaches: Estimated cost - Free entry. Estimated time spent - 3 hours
  • Wings of Time Show: Estimated cost - Check prices here. Estimated time spent - 30 minutes
Friday, February 9: Discovering Chinatown

Immerse yourself in the vibrant culture of Chinatown. In the morning, visit the Buddha Tooth Relic Temple and Museum, a stunning architectural masterpiece. Marvel at the sacred relics and artifacts on display. Afterward, explore the narrow streets filled with traditional shops and eateries. Enjoy a delicious lunch at a local hawker center. In the afternoon, visit the historic Thian Hock Keng Temple and learn about the rich history of Chinese immigrants in Singapore. End the day with a romantic dinner at one of the charming Chinese restaurants in the area.

  • Buddha Tooth Relic Temple and Museum: Estimated cost - Free entry. Estimated time spent - 2 hours
  • Exploring Chinatown: Estimated cost - Varies depending on activities. Estimated time spent - 3 hours
  • Thian Hock Keng Temple: Estimated cost - Free entry. Estimated time spent - 1 hour
  • Chinatown Dining: Estimated cost - Varies depending on restaurant. Estimated time spent - 2 hours
Saturday, February 10: Sentosa Island Adventures

Continue exploring Sentosa Island with more adventurous activities. In the morning, visit the S.E.A. Aquarium, home to a vast array of marine life. Marvel at the stunning exhibits and walk through the underwater tunnel. In the afternoon, take an exhilarating zipline adventure at Mega Adventure Park. Enjoy panoramic views of the island as you glide through the air. End the day with a romantic sunset cable car ride, offering breathtaking vistas of the city skyline.

  • S.E.A. Aquarium: Estimated cost - Check prices here. Estimated time spent - 3 hours
  • Mega Adventure Park: Estimated cost - Check prices here. Estimated time spent - 2 hours
  • Sentosa Cable Car: Estimated cost - Check prices here. Estimated time spent - 1 hour
Sunday, February 11: City Exploration and Marina Bay Sands

Embark on a city exploration starting with a visit to the Merlion Park in the morning. Admire the iconic statue and enjoy panoramic views of the city skyline. In the afternoon, explore the futuristic Gardens by the Bay and take a leisurely walk along the OCBC Skyway for stunning views. Visit the ArtScience Museum for unique exhibitions. As the evening sets in, head to the famous Marina Bay Sands and enjoy a romantic dinner at one of its world-class restaurants overlooking the city.

  • Merlion Park: Estimated cost - Free entry. Estimated time spent - 1 hour
  • Gardens by the Bay and OCBC Skyway: Estimated cost - Free entry, additional fees for OCBC Skyway. Estimated time spent - 3 hours
  • ArtScience Museum: Estimated cost - Check prices here. Estimated time spent - 2 hours
  • Dinner at Marina Bay Sands: Estimated cost - Varies depending on restaurant. Estimated time spent - 2 hours
Monday, February 12: Historic Landmarks and Night Safari

Explore Singapore's historic landmarks in the morning. Start with a visit to the National Museum of Singapore, where you can learn about the country's rich history and culture. Take a stroll along the Singapore River and admire the beautiful colonial buildings. In the afternoon, visit the iconic Raffles Hotel and indulge in a traditional afternoon tea. As the sun sets, head to the Singapore Night Safari and embark on a unique wildlife adventure under the stars.

  • National Museum of Singapore: Estimated cost - Check prices here. Estimated time spent - 2 hours
  • Singapore River Walk: Estimated cost - Free. Estimated time spent - 1 hour
  • Afternoon Tea at Raffles Hotel: Estimated cost - Check prices here. Estimated time spent - 2 hours
  • Singapore Night Safari: Estimated cost - Check prices here. Estimated time spent - 3 hours
Tuesday, February 13: Shopping and Dining Delights

Spend your last day exploring Singapore's shopping and culinary scene. Start with a visit to Orchard Road, a shopper's paradise filled with luxury malls and boutiques. Indulge in retail therapy and find the perfect souvenirs. In the afternoon, head to Little India and immerse yourself in the vibrant Indian culture. Explore the colorful streets, visit temples, and sample delicious Indian cuisine. End your honeymoon with a romantic dinner cruise along the Singapore River, enjoying the city's sparkling skyline.

  • Orchard Road: Estimated cost - Varies depending on shopping. Estimated time spent - 4 hours
  • Little India: Estimated cost - Free. Estimated time spent - 3 hours
  • Dinner Cruise: Estimated cost - Check prices here. Estimated time spent - 2 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For a unique experience, consider visiting the Haji Lane in Kampong Glam, a colorful street filled with independent boutiques and trendy cafes. Explore the vibrant street art scene in the Tiong Bahru neighborhood, where you can discover hidden murals and enjoy a cup of coffee in a charming cafe. For a taste of local cuisine, venture into the hawker centers and try dishes like Hainanese chicken rice, laksa, and chili crab. These off-the-beaten-path attractions and local favorites will add a special touch to your honeymoon in Singapore.
